The average solar installation cost in Colorado in 2025 ranges between $17,000 and $21,000 for a 6-kilowatt (kW) residential system before incentives. That equates to about $2.70 to $3.20 per watt, slightly above the national average due to Colorado’s higher labor and permitting expenses. After claiming the 30% federal Investment Tax Credit (ITC), most homeowners pay between $11,900 and $14,700 for a full system.

This cost typically includes everything required for a complete installation, solar panels, inverters, racking, wiring, permitting, and labor. Homeowners who add a battery system can expect an additional $9,000 to $13,000, depending on the capacity and brand.

Below is a cost breakdown showing how hardware and soft costs contribute to the total price of a solar system in Colorado.

Component Estimated Share of Total Cost Details
Solar panels 25% – 30% High-efficiency monocrystalline modules are common due to Colorado’s intense sunlight.
Inverters 8% – 12% String or microinverters convert DC to AC power for home use.
Racking and wiring 6% – 8% Mounting systems and cabling built to withstand Colorado’s snow and wind loads.
Batteries (optional) 15% – 20% Energy storage for backup power and grid independence.
Labor 10% – 15% Skilled electricians and roof specialists handle the installation.
Permitting and inspection 3% – 5% Includes local and utility interconnection fees.
Overhead and profit 10% – 12% Covers insurance, administration, and sales.

Colorado homeowners generally achieve payback periods between 8 and 12 years, depending on local utility rates and energy use. Over the system’s 25- to 30-year lifespan, most households save $20,000 to $35,000 in avoided electricity costs.

Finding the Right Solar Installer in Colorado

Choosing the right solar installer is crucial to the success and safety of your system. Colorado’s growing solar market includes hundreds of solar installation companies, but not all offer the same experience, warranties, or transparency. Working with a qualified solar panel installer ensures the system is installed to code, passes inspections, and delivers optimal performance year-round.

When searching for a solar installation company, look for the following key qualities:

  • Licensing and Certification: A reputable installer should hold a Colorado electrical contractor’s license and employ North American Board of Certified Energy Practitioners (NABCEP) certified technicians. This certification demonstrates advanced knowledge of photovoltaic (PV) system design and safety standards
  • Experience and Local Expertise: Installers familiar with Colorado’s climate, especially snow load and hail considerations, will design systems with optimal tilt angles and durable mounting hardware
  • Transparent Pricing: The installer should provide a clear cost breakdown, including equipment, labor, and solar permits, without hidden fees
  • Comprehensive Warranties: Reliable companies offer at least 10-year workmanship warranties, with equipment warranties of 25 years or more
  • Strong References and Reviews: Customer feedback and industry recognition can reveal how well the installer supports clients after installation

Working with an established solar installation company also simplifies post-installation maintenance and warranty claims. Many leading Colorado installers provide in-house monitoring services, ensuring that homeowners quickly detect and resolve any drop in energy production.

What Permits Do You Need to Install Solar Panels in Colorado?

Colorado homeowners must secure several solar permits before installation can begin. These ensure the system meets safety codes and utility interconnection requirements. Permitting processes vary slightly across municipalities, but they generally include:

  • Building and Electrical Permits: Issued by the local jurisdiction (city or county), these ensure that solar panel systems meet the Colorado Electrical Code and applicable fire and structural standards
  • Utility Interconnection Approval: Utilities such as Xcel Energy, Black Hills Energy, and local cooperatives require approval to connect the system to the grid. This includes submitting system specifications and inverter certifications
  • Homeowners Association (HOA) Permits: Colorado law prevents HOAs from banning rooftop solar but allows them to impose reasonable aesthetic restrictions. Homeowners must typically submit design plans for approval to comply with HOA rules

Many solar installation companies handle these permits on behalf of clients as part of their project management services. However, homeowners should still confirm that the permit fees are included in the solar installation proposal and final pricing.

How to Evaluate a Colorado Solar Proposal

A solar installation proposal is a detailed document provided by solar companies outlining projected energy savings, system specifications, and total costs. It differs from a solar installation contract, which is the legally binding agreement executed once you decide to proceed.

Homeowners should always request multiple proposals from different installers before signing a contract. Comparing several proposals ensures you get competitive pricing, reliable equipment, and transparent terms.

A standard Colorado solar proposal should include the following:

  • System Size and Estimated Energy Production: Expressed in kilowatts (kW) and kilowatt-hours (kWh) per year, calculated using tools such as PVWatts
  • Total System Cost and Payment Options: Including cash purchase, solar lease, loan, or power purchase agreement
  • Equipment Specifications: Brand and model of panels, inverters, and any batteries
  • Expected Payback Period and Lifetime Savings: Based on current utility rates and incentives
  • Warranties and Maintenance: Details about workmanship and equipment warranties
  • Permit and Interconnection Timelines: Estimated schedule for completing solar permits and inspections

What to Look for in Colorado Solar Installation Contracts

A solar installation contract formalizes your agreement with the installer and outlines each party’s responsibilities. It is required for nearly all solar installations in Colorado. The contract ensures compliance with state laws and protects homeowners from incomplete or substandard work.

Below are the key sections you should expect in a well-written Colorado solar contract.

System Specifications and Scope of Work

This section lists the equipment, design, and capacity of your solar system. It should clearly define the make and model of all major components, including panels, inverters, and mounting equipment. A transparent scope of work ensures both parties understand what is being installed and how it will perform.

Installation Timeline

Colorado’s weather can affect installation schedules, so the contract should specify start and completion dates, as well as conditions that may delay work (such as permitting or supply issues). Reputable solar installers typically complete residential projects within four to eight weeks after permitting.

Payment Schedule

The contract must outline when payments are due, often divided into a deposit, mid-project milestone, and final payment after inspection. Homeowners should avoid paying the full cost upfront. Payment schedules tied to permit approvals and inspections offer better protection.

Warranties and Performance Guarantees

Look for detailed warranty coverage. A solid solar installation contract should include:

  • Workmanship Warranty: Typically 10 years, covering installation errors
  • Equipment Warranty: At least 25 years on panels and 10 to 15 years on inverters
  • Performance Guarantee: Ensures the system will generate a specific amount of power annually; if production falls short, the installer compensates for the loss

Maintenance and Service Terms

Clarify who is responsible for monitoring, cleaning, and servicing the system. Some solar installation companies include annual maintenance or production monitoring in their contracts, while others offer it as an add-on service.

Transfer and Ownership Clauses

This section explains what happens if you sell your home. The contract should specify whether warranties and system ownership transfer to the new homeowner. Colorado’s net metering policies allow ownership transfers without losing interconnection benefits.

Cancellation and Dispute Resolution

Ensure the contract includes a cancellation clause allowing withdrawal under specific conditions, such as excessive delays or permit denials. Dispute resolution procedures, including mediation or arbitration, help avoid legal conflicts later.

How to Read Colorado Solar Leases

A solar lease (also known as a power purchase agreement) allows homeowners to use solar energy without buying the system outright. Instead, they agree to pay a fixed monthly rate or per-kilowatt-hour fee for the electricity the system generates, while a third-party company owns and maintains the panels.

When reviewing a solar lease, pay attention to these major terms:

  • Contract Length: Most leases last 15 to 25 years. Confirm the start and end dates, and any options for renewal or early termination
  • Buyout Option: Some agreements let you purchase the system after a set number of years, usually at fair market value
  • Escalator Clause: This determines whether payments increase annually, commonly by 1% to 3%. Consider how these increases compare to expected utility rate hikes
  • Maintenance and Repairs: Since the system is owned by the lessor, the company should cover all maintenance, inverter replacements, and monitoring
  • Insurance and Liability: The contract should specify which party is responsible for insuring the system against damage or theft
  • End-of-Term Options: Confirm what happens when the lease ends, whether the panels are removed, replaced, or transferred to your ownership

Understanding these details prevents future surprises and ensures you benefit from predictable energy costs throughout the lease term. Even when leasing, homeowners must ensure the solar permits and interconnection paperwork are filed correctly, typically handled by the solar installer or third-party provider.